An Overview of Hydraulic Oil Seal Materials


Hydraulic systems are crucial components in various industrial and automotive applications, providing the necessary pressure to perform tasks efficiently. One of the key components of these systems is the hydraulic oil seal. The performance and longevity of hydraulic systems heavily depend on the quality of the oil seals used. In this article, we will explore the different materials utilized in manufacturing hydraulic oil seals and their respective benefits and drawbacks.


Understanding Hydraulic Oil Seals


Hydraulic oil seals are designed to prevent fluid leaks and contamination in hydraulic systems. They typically consist of a flexible elastomeric material, which allows them to maintain a tight seal under varying pressure and temperature conditions. The choice of material in hydraulic oil seals directly influences their performance effectiveness, durability, and resistance to wear and tear.


Common Materials Used in Hydraulic Oil Seals


1. Nitrile Rubber (NBR) Nitrile rubber is the most widely used material for hydraulic oil seals due to its excellent resistance to petroleum-based oils and hydraulic fluids. It offers good elasticity and maintains sealing properties over a wide temperature range, generally from -30°C to 100°C. However, its effectiveness may decrease in the presence of solvents and high temperatures, limiting its use in extreme conditions.


2. Fluorocarbon (FKM) Fluorocarbon seals, commonly known by the brand name Viton, are excellent in high-temperature and chemical resistance applications. They can endure temperatures up to 200°C and are compatible with a wide variety of fluids, including aggressive chemicals and biofuels. However, they are relatively more expensive and may not provide adequate sealing in applications requiring flexibility and lower temperature conditions.

3. Polyurethane (PU) Polyurethane seals exhibit outstanding abrasion resistance and resilience. They can operate effectively in both dynamic and static sealing applications. Polyurethane material can withstand extreme environmental conditions, including exposure to water and various chemicals. However, they can become brittle at high temperatures and are generally not recommended for environments where the temperature exceeds 80°C.


4. Silicone Rubber Silicone rubber is often used in applications requiring excellent temperature stability, ranging from -60°C to 200°C. It has outstanding resistance to aging and allows for flexibility at both high and low temperatures. However, silicone is not as resistant to oils, making it less suitable for hydraulic applications where oil exposure is prevalent.


5. Leather and Fabric-Reinforced Materials In some traditional applications, leather and fabric-reinforced rubber have been utilized for hydraulic seals. While they may offer good flexibility and moderate resistance to oils, their durability and effectiveness compared to synthetic materials are limited. These materials are becoming increasingly rare in modern applications as synthetic options outperform them.


Considerations for Selecting Seal Materials


When selecting the appropriate material for hydraulic oil seals, there are several factors to consider - Compatibility with Fluids The seal material must be compatible with the hydraulic fluid used in the system to prevent premature degradation. - Temperature Range Knowing the operating temperature range is essential for selecting a material that can withstand the conditions without losing its sealing properties. - Application Type Dynamic seals will have different requirements compared to static seals, influencing the choice of material. - Cost vs. Performance Balancing cost with the desired performance characteristics is crucial for sustainable operations.


Conclusion


The material selection for hydraulic oil seals is vital for ensuring the efficiency and longevity of hydraulic systems. With a variety of options available—each with its unique strengths and weaknesses—it's essential for engineers and manufacturers to understand the specific requirements of their applications. By choosing the right materials, industries can significantly enhance the reliability and efficiency of their hydraulic systems, minimizing downtime and maintenance costs.
